Reviews: Bavarian Salt Mine Tour and Berchtesgaden
Guest User2026-01-03
Our guide Philip was humorous, friendly, and informative. Since the salt mine opens at around 11 AM, Philip drove us around the Bavarian Alps to enjoy some incredible views before he took us to the mine. The salt mine was also a fun experience. We slid down two slides and had a beautiful boat ride across a “salt lake”. After the salt mine tour, my partner and I had other plans in Berchtesgaden, and Philip was kind enough to drop us off at the location before he took the rest of the group back to Salzburg.
